Synopsis
This play is based on "Occupe-toi d'Amelie" by Georges Feydeau. Look After Lulu! is a comedy about a prostitute whose lover Philippe is enlisted in the army. This friend tricks her into a mock wedding. Look After Lulu is a farce. The play is set in Paris in the early 1900s.
